Two people were injured in a plane crash, Monday night, on a Detroit street. According to authorities and the Associated Press, that small plane crash landed on a residential street. The pilot apparently had to land because they were running out of fuel. The pilot was injured, as was a bystander who was electrocuted by a power cable that the aircraft brought down. The Federal Aviation Administration says an investigation into the crash will likely take a few weeks.
